OFFICE PROFILE : The Office of Undergraduate Admissions at Concordia University Irvine exists to serve the mission of the university by recruiting and enrolling a specific number of wise, honorable and cultivated undergraduate students that support the ongoing operations of the university.

ROLE : The role of the Visits and Events Coordinator is to create a strategic plan for events and visits, in consultation with the Director of Undergraduate Admissions.

The purpose of this role is to attract as many prospective students to visit Concordia University Irvine through a customized visit experience and / or admissions events that highlight the student experience at Concordia University Irvine.

This role will be pivotal in its contribution to the annual enrollment goals of the Undergraduate Admissions Office.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ES : To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to accomplish each of the below duties satisfactorily :

  • In consultation with the Director of Admissions, manages the overall strategy, design, and execution of all customized and personalized prospective students visits, group visits and all events for undergraduate admissions including but not limited to : Saturday Brunch Tours, Preview Day, Scholar's Breakfast, Scholar's Reception, Transfer Day, Admitted Student Day, and Week of Welcome.
  • Assist the Director of Admissions in creating strategic goals and objectives within Admissions through the active development of new and revamped events.
  • Manage all events to operate effectively within the operating budget set by the Director of Admissions.
  • Serve as liaison between the Admissions, deans, departmental faculty, and staff responsible for the implementation of successful recruitment events.
  • Serve as liaison between university catering services, Bon Appetit, and all off-campus vendors.
  • Responsible for providing content and maintaining university event website information and guest reservation programs.
  • In consultation with the Director of Admissions, draft and prepare all written communication including emails, letters, reservation forms and all recruitment event publications.
  • Manage all content, overall layout and design of all event programs, nametags, signage and all other printed items for each event.
  • Manage and implement the Admissions Event Management CRM (Salesforce) while working in conjunction with the Associate Director of Operations for all related issues.
  • Manage contracts for all vendor services and products in relation to all event needs.
  • Train, manage, and maintain a successful student staff of 10-15 student workers to assist in the execution of each event and facilitate development of their communication skills and overall work experience in the field of event planning.
  • Other duties may be assigned over time.
